Field Service Engineer
Job Summary
The Field Service Engineer (FSE) is responsible for the installation, servicing and maintenance of Rigaku X-ray Diffraction (XRD) and X-ray Fluorescence (XRF) systems in Singapore, with occasional onsite support across Southeast Asia. The FSE is expected to provide prompt and competent technical support, meet applicable Mean Time to Repair (MTTR) targets, and contribute to a high-quality customer experience.
Key Responsibilities
· Carry out service assignments and other tasks assigned by the reporting manager.
· Install, service, troubleshoot and maintain Rigaku X-ray equipment, and provide customer training as required.
· Complete work reports and weekly timesheets accurately and professionally.
· Provide hotline technical support to customers and business partners as required.
· Meet applicable productivity and billable-hour targets.
· Comply with applicable radiation safety requirements, regulatory requirements and Company procedures when installing, servicing and maintaining X-ray equipment.
· Participate in overseas technical and product training and develop the required technical competencies for the role.
· Undertake other duties and responsibilities as required according to evolving business and customer needs
Requirements
· Diploma or Degree in Electrical Engineering,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Physics, Materials Engineering, or related technical discipline.
· Experience with X-ray equipment is preferred. Candidates with relevant engineering projects or practical technical experience gained during their studies may also be considered.
· Strong spoken and written English.
· Additional language capabilities would be an advantage.
· Good inter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to work effectively with customers, distributors and internal stakeholders across different countries and cultures.
· Willingness to travel for business, which may account for up to approximately 20% of working time.
